I'm under NDA and very paranoid, so I won't do a full run down :) . But I am very impressed with it. Right now the tech test is little more than run, shoot, and capture bases, but I'm still really impressed. I'll be fascinated when they add certs for testing.

When you're playing you can really tell SOE is putting a lot of eggs into this basket. Smed is online practically every night sending out messages, assuring us the bugs/balance issues players mention on the forums are being addressed. And the devs are playing too.

Since it's a tech test, I can't go away without mentioning that the game has been surprisingly stable with hundreds of players on screen. This is on high settings too. The potential for huge open scale battles is here. In fact I've already been part of a few. It's quite a scene to be running over a hill with a squad only to see a battlefield in a valley with tanks on both sides blowing everything to hell.

If they stay true to what's been promised so far, they should have one hell of a game come release. I was hugely addicted to Battlefield 2, and right now without the certs/outfits its a much nicer looking/larger scale version of that. Keep an eye out for this one if you like FPS's.
